About the Role

You will be pro-active in building your portfolio base and actively manage your customers to ensure all needs are explored and the right solutions offered.

You have a deep level of Home Lending experience and knowledge.

More broadly, you will:

Draw from extensive experience in products, processes, policies and lending risk appetite to describe options and value propositions, answer questions and resolve objections effectively

Develop a reputation for being a trusted advisor by guiding customers and business partners on the lending journey. Build advocates and focus on how CBA can deliver authentic and long terms relationships

Embody our values, create followership and drive success with a team of passionate lenders

Proactively research and utilise industry and customer network to enhance and share knowledge of Regulatory requirements and its impacts on the market, industry, customers and the Group

Develop and maintain internal and external referral sources and effectively ask for business and coach others in how to ask for business through deeper and proactively customer and business partner relationship. Build own referral partner network externally.

Show advanced application of the Group’s risk framework to attract and retain customers. Effectively question risk situations and encourage a speak-up culture.


What will help you succeed?

Track record of delivering excellent customer service through a proven ability to establish and maintain effective and rewarding relationships.

World class customer pipeline management skills

Prior proven experience within a lending/sales environment

Knowledge of retail lending with the ability to identify and anticipate customers’ financial needs

Demonstrated understanding of Home Lending products and the current national home lending legislation

Ability to coach and upskill peers

Advanced business and market acumen
